12/2/ University of Utah Health Sciences Center Didactic Lectures vs. Presentation u Didactic Lectures Formal lectures given to internal students Audience scope often medical students, fellows and residents More of a one time lecture, not ongoing u Presentation Special invitation to present Audience scope is external Can have international, national, regional, or local impact Most often given at a formal, professional conference

12/2/ University of Utah Health Sciences Center Should I Know the Difference? u Editor: Responsible for the editorial aspects of the journal Associate Editor Assistant Editor Guest Editor u Editor in Chief: The editor having final responsibility for the operations and policies of a publication u Editorial Board: A group of people who dictate the tone and direction of the publications editorials will take Member Executive Board u Referee: Participation in formal review process of scholarly journal articles Reviewer Ad Hoc Reviewer Ad Hoc Referee

12/2/ University of Utah Health Sciences Center What am I Supposed to do with Grants?! u Flow: Grant Application/Award Process u Types of Grants: Who are the Sponsors? u Why Do They Give Us the Money? u What Forms Does the Money Come In?

12/2/ University of Utah Health Sciences Center Grant Application/Award Process u IRB – Institutional Review Board Human Subjects Approval u IACUC – Institutional Animal Care and Use Committee Animal Protocol Approval u Application to Sponsor u WAITING... u Award u Renewal

12/2/ University of Utah Health Sciences Center Who Are The Sponsors? u 32 Sponsor Types as defined by the Office of Sponsored Projects PHS/Public Health Service State Funding Industry Miscellaneous Funding u 4,825 Sponsors National Eye Institute National Institute on Aging u Determining who the entity is, and where it is (or where it belongs in the system) is the most complex step

12/2/ University of Utah Health Sciences Center Why Do They Give Us The Money? u Research Projects u Clinical Contracts u Clinical Trials u Training Grants

12/2/ University of Utah Health Sciences Center What Forms Does The Money Come In? u Grant – for support of research activity; usually requires progress reporting u Contract – for services rendered u Other – for other types of extramural funding “Peer-Reviewed” u NIH Grants: R01, K08... u NSF Grants u Foundation Grants (American Heart Association, American Cancer Society) Non “Peer-Reviewed” u Industry Grants u Private Grants u Contracts
